• [技术干货] 智慧园区创建设备规格到设备库(Device_createDefToTemplateLibrary)接口说明
    创建设备规格到设备库。注意事项无。基本信息接口名称Device_createDefToTemplateLibrary接口路径/service/Device/0.1.0/TemplateLibrary/create接口协议HTTPS接口方法POST请求参数表1 请求参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言,如zh_CN。deviceDefIdStringMBody本地设备规格ID请求样例{ "deviceDefId": "0507000000fbQmAlF4Vs" }响应参数表2 响应参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义resultOutputsMBody接口响应参数。resCodeStringMBody返回码。resMsgStringOBody返回消息。表3 Outputs参数说明 名称类型必选(M)/可选(O)位置描述deviceDefIdStringOOutputs设备规格IDoldDeviceDefIdStringOOutputs原始设备规格IDtemplateIdStringOOutputs设备规格模板ID表4 响应码 状态码描述200 OK接口调用成功。响应样例{ "resCode": "0", "resMsg": "成功", "result": { "deviceDefId": "c00d000000fjkGX6am0W", "oldDeviceDefId": "0507000000fbQmAlF4Vs", "templateId": "c00d000000fjkGX6am0W" } }
  • [问题求助] 大数据的数据加工里面的作业调度时间不正确
    作业自调度时间日期错误,导致数据都没有统计进去下图为作业自己调度的日志,查询时间错误下图为作业手动测试执行的日志
  • [技术干货] 智慧园区批量导出告警历史(exportAlarmHistoryForBatch)接口说明
    该接口用于根据给定条件导出相应的历史告警数据。返回结果为待导出的告警数据表和告警数量。注意事项无。基本信息接口名称exportAlarmHistoryForBatch接口路径/service/Alarm/0.1.0/AlarmHistory/exportForBatch接口协议HTTPS接口方法POST请求参数请求参数如表1所示。表1 请求参数说明名称类型必选(M)/可选(O)位置描述access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言。如zh_CN、en_US。默认为zh_CN。alarmIdsString[]OBody导出告警的告警ID。长度范围:20字节。alarmLevelStringOBody导出告警的告警等级。INFO:提示NORMAL:普通MAJOR:重要CRITICAL:严重alarmNumberStringOBody导出告警的告警编号。长度范围:1~64字节。alarmStatusStringOBody导出告警的告警状态。CLOSED:已关闭CANCELED :取消alarmTypeStringOBody导出告警的告警类型。长度范围:20字节。countFlagStringOBody是否返回告警数量,默认为“1”,其他情况不返回。fromTimeDateOBody导出告警的起始时间。toTimeDateOBody导出告警的结束时间。limitStringOBody导出告警的条数。(min:0,max:5000)startStringOBody导出告警的起始游标,默认0。closeBeginTimeStringOBody告警历史的关闭起始时间。closeEndTimeStringOBody告警历史的关闭结束时间。spaceString[]OBody导出告警的空间1~128字节alarmCategoryString[]OBody导出告警的告警分类标志符。1~64字节请求样例{ "alarmLevel": "INFO", "fromTime": "2019-11-11 11:00:47", "toTime": "2021-01-20 11:00:47", "limit": 10, "start": 0 }响应参数响应参数如表2所示。表2 响应参数说明名称类型必选(M)/可选(O)位置描述resCodeStringMBody服务的返回码。resMsgStringOBody接口的返回消息。totalNumberNumberOBody成功导出告警实例的数目。resultString[]MBody成功导出的告警实例。titleStringOBody成功导出告警实例的标题响应样例{ "resCode": "0", "resMsg": "成功", "result": [ { "result": [ { "id": "0C01000000gcqMXH7uWe", "关闭时间": "2021-01-18 15:46:49", "发生位置": "A基地A区", "发生时间": "2021-01-18 15:46:13", "告警状态": "取消", "告警等级": "提示", "告警类型": "BA设备告警", "告警编号": "device_2021011800000127", "描述": null, "标题": "设备告警-BA设备告警" } ], "title": [ "id", "告警编号", "标题", "描述", "告警等级", "告警类型", "发生位置", "发生时间", "关闭时间", "告警状态" ], "totalNumber": null } ] }
  • [技术干货] 智慧园区批量导出告警(exportAlarmForBatch)接口说明
    该接口用于根据给定条件导出相应的告警数据。返回结果为待导出的告警数据表和告警数量。注意事项无。基本信息接口名称exportAlarmForBatch接口路径/service/Alarm/0.1.0/Alarm/exportForBatch接口协议HTTPS接口方法POST请求参数请求参数如表1所示。表1 请求参数说明名称类型必选(M)/可选(O)位置描述access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言。如zh_CN、en_US。默认为zh_CN。alarmIdsString[]OBody导出告警的告警ID。20字节。alarmLevelStringOBody导出告警的告警等级。INFO:提示NORMAL:普通MAJOR:重要CRITICAL:严重alarmNumberStringOBody导出告警的告警编号。1~64字节。alarmStatusStringOBody导出告警的告警状态。CREATED:已创建CONFIRMED:已确认HANDLING:处理中PENDING:挂起中alarmTypeStringOBody导出告警的告警类型。20字节。countFlagStringOBody是否返回告警数量,默认为“1”,其他情况不返回。fromTimeDateOBody导出告警的起始时间。toTimeDateOBody导出告警的结束时间。limitStringOBody导出告警的条数。min:0,max:5000startStringOBody导出告警的起始游标,默认0。spaceString[]OBody导出告警的空间,1~128字节alarmCategoryString[]OBody导出告警的告警分类标志符。1~64字节请求样例{ "cursor": "10", "fromTime": "2020-01-10 00:00:00", "isIncrement": true, "toTime": "2021-01-20 00:00:00", "limit":10 }响应参数响应参数如表2所示。表2 响应参数说明名称类型必选(M)/可选(O)位置描述resCodeStringMBody服务的返回码。resMsgStringOBody接口的返回消息。resultString[]OBody成功导出的告警实例。totalNumberNumberOBody成功导出告警实例的数目。titleStringOBody成功导出告警实例的标题。响应样例{ "resCode": "0", "resMsg": "成功", "result": [ { "result": [ { "id": "0504000000gey0Rvoohk", "发生位置": "室外", "发生时间": "2021-01-19 22:28:56", "告警状态": "已确认", "告警等级": "严重", "告警类型": "异常事件", "告警编号": "SEC_2021011900001857", "描述": "测试", "标题": "安全告警-异常事件" } ], "title": [ "id", "告警编号", "标题", "描述", "告警等级", "告警类型", "发生位置", "发生时间", "告警状态" ], "totalNumber": null } ] }
  • [问题求助] 在这个应用下开发了roma接口,在appcube同步应用接口报错
    在这个应用下开发了roma接口,在appcube同步应用接口报错
  • [问题求助] 今天新开通的大数据基线开发,作业成功数据不能存到目标表
    账号:Hibmtech
  • [技术干货] 智慧园区新增时间表策略(addTimeScheduleStrategy)接口说明
    该接口用于新增时间表策略。注意事项无。基本信息接口名称addTimeScheduleStrategy接口路径/service/Device/0.1.0/TimeScheduleStrategy/add接口协议HTTPS接口方法POST请求参数表1 请求参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言。如zh_CN。campusProjectStringMBody园区位置nameStringMBody名称remarkStringOBody时间表策略描述detailTimeScheduleStrategyDetail[]MBody时间表策略详情表2 TimeScheduleStrategyDetail 参数名称类型必选(M)/可选(O)参数位置参数含义deviceStringMTimeScheduleStrategyDetail设备IDcontrolPointStringMTimeScheduleStrategyDetail设备控制属性点settingValueStringMTimeScheduleStrategyDetail设定值delayExecutionTimeNumberMTimeScheduleStrategyDetail延迟执行时间serviceCodeStringMTimeScheduleStrategyDetail指令编码请求样例{ "campusProject": ""; "name": ""; "detail": [{ "device": "", "controlPoint": "", "settingValue": "", "delayExecutionTime": 1, "serviceCode": "" }] }响应参数表3 响应参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义resultOutputsMBody接口响应参数。resCodeStringMBody返回码。resMsgStringOBody返回消息。表4 Outputs 参数名称类型必选(M)/可选(O)参数位置参数含义idStringMOutputs时间表策略ID表5 响应码 状态码描述200 OK接口调用成功。响应样例{ "resCode": "0", "resMsg": "成功", "result": { "id": "" } }
  • [技术干货] 智慧园区删除时间表策略(deleteTimeScheduleStrategy)接口说明
    该接口用于删除时间表策略。注意事项无。基本信息接口名称deleteTimeScheduleStrategy接口路径/service/Device/0.1.0/TimeScheduleStrategy/delete接口协议HTTPS接口方法POST请求参数表1 请求参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言。如zh_CN。idsString[]MBody删除的时间表策略的ID数组。请求样例{ "ids": [ "0D07000000fh3ap4PA5A", "0D07000000fh3ap4PA5B" ] }响应参数表2 响应参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义resultOutputsMBody接口响应参数。resCodeStringMBody返回码。resMsgStringOBody返回消息。表3 Outputs 参数名称类型必选(M)/可选(O)参数位置参数含义countNumberMOutputs删除记录数表4 响应码 状态码描述200 OK接口调用成功。响应样例{ "resCode": "0", "resMsg": "成功", "result": { "count": 2 } }
  • [技术干货] 智慧园区作废设备实例(discardDevice)接口说明
    该接口用于变更设备实例的生命周期状态为已作废。当设备实例已经下线了不再投入使用,可以调用此接口将状态改为已作废。从其他任何状态都可以进入已作废状态,设备重新导入或者重新发起自注册时,设备会被重新激活为已启用状态。注意事项无。基本信息接口名称discardDevice接口路径/service/Device/0.1.0/discardDevice/{id}接口协议HTTPS接口方法POST请求参数请求参数如表1所示。表1 请求参数说明参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言,如zh_CN。idStringMPath将被作废的设备实例的数据ID。请求样例无响应参数响应参数如表2所示。表2 响应参数说明参数名称类型必选(M)/可选(O)参数位置参数含义resultOutputs[]MBody接口响应参数。resCodeStringMBody返回码。resMsgStringOBody返回消息。响应样例{ "resCode": "0", "resMsg": "成功", "result": [{ }] }
  • [技术干货] 智慧园区主动查询当前设备的属性值(Device_queryDeviceRealtimeAttr)接口说明
    该接口用于主动查询设备的属性值。入参的设备的deviceId,支持多个,最多是15个。设备BO收到请求后,依据设备的deviceId反查获取所属网关的Id,设备BO通过IO的指令下发接口,向网关设备发送指令,令网关采集指定子设备当前的属性数据。注意事项对于直连设备、非HLink网关的子设备,当前不支持,接口直接返回错误。基本信息接口名称Device_queryDeviceRealtimeAttr接口路径/service/Device/0.1.0/DeviceRealtimeAttr/query接口协议HTTPS接口方法POST请求参数表1 请求参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ringMHeader当前界面语言,如zh_CN。deviceIdsString[]MBody设备实例的ID。traceIdStringOBody用于拨测调试的关键字deviceCodesString[]OBody设备实例的code。说明:当“deviceCodes”和“deviceIds”同时传入时,以“deviceIds”为准,传入“deviceCodes”时,要保证“deviceIds”为空列表。deviceNumbersString[]OBody设备实例的设备编号说明:当“deviceNumbers”与其他入参同时传入时,以“deviceNumbers”为准,其他入参不处理,要保证“deviceIds”为空列表请求样例{ "deviceIds": ["050C000000aW9Q7WfihE"] }响应参数表2 响应参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义resCodeStringMBody返回码。resMsgStringOBody返回消息。resultObjectOBody设备服务的响应参数。响应样例{ "resCode": "0", "resMsg": "成功", "result": [{ }] }
  • [问题求助] sql语句在控制台能查询,在脚本里面执行报错,我看了8月25号更新了版本,在8月25之前是没问题的
    sql语句在控制台能查询,在脚本里面执行报错,我看了8月25号更新了版本,在8月25之前是没问题的
  • [技术干货] 智慧园区创建设备关系类型(Device_addDeviceRelationType)接口说明
    该接口用来创建设备关系类型。注意事项无。基本信息接口名称Device_addDeviceRelationType接口路径/service/Device/0.1.0/RelationType/add接口协议HTTPS接口方法POST请求参数表1 请求参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言。如zh_CN。codeStringMBody设备关联关系类型的标识符relationNameStringMBody设备关联关系类型的名称,多语言资源IDdescriptionStringMBody设备关联关系类型描述modeStringOBody设备关联关系模型请求样例{ "code": "TEST", "relationName": "测试", "mode": "ADJACENT", "description": "备注" }响应参数表2 响应参数说明 参数名称类型必选(M)/可选(O)参数位置参数含义resultOutputsMBody接口响应参数。resCodeStringMBody返回码。resMsgStringOBody返回消息。表3 Outputs 参数名称类型必选(M)/可选(O)参数位置参数含义idStringMBody/result/outputs新创建的设备关联关系类型的ID响应样例{ "resCode": "0", "resMsg": "成功", "result": { "id": "0F24000000fgzcHHq12m" } }
  • [技术干货] 智慧园区查询设备关系类型(queryDeviceRelationType)接口说明
    该接口用于查询设备关系列表。注意事项无。基本信息接口名称queryDeviceRelationType接口路径/service/Device/0.1.0/queryDeviceRelationType接口协议HTTPS接口方法POST请求参数请求参数说明如表1所示。表1 请求参数说明参数名称类型必选(M)/可选(O)参数位置参数含义access-tokenStringMCookie | Header授权TOKEN。localeStringOHeader当前界面语言。如zh_CN。conditionQueryConditionMBody查询参数对象。startNumberMBody起始行数。(min:0)limitNumberMBody本次查询要求返回的行数。(min:0)表2 QueryCondition 参数名称类型必选(M)/可选(O)参数位置参数含义idParameterOQueryCondition设备关系类型Id。codeParameterOQueryCondition设备关系类型编码。relationNameParameterOQueryCondition设备关系类型名称。relationModeParameterOQueryCondition设备关系类型模式。lastModifiedDateParameterOQueryCondition设备关系类型的最后更新时间。表3 Parameter 参数名称类型必选(M)/可选(O)参数位置参数含义valueAnyOParameter查询条件的参数值。当算子为in或between时,参数值为一个数组。valueListAny[]OParameter查询条件的参数值,为数组,算法为in或者between的时候传这个。operatorStringOParameter查询条件的算子。包括:=,<,>,like,in。不同的查询条件所允许的算子不同。不填则默认为=。请求样例{ "start": 0, "limit": 5, "condition": { "relationMode": { "value": "ADJACENT", "operator": "=" } } }响应参数表4 Outputs 参数名称类型必选(M)/可选(O)参数位置参数含义relationTypeRelationType[]MBody/result/outputs符合查询条件的设备关系类型列表。countIntegerMBody/result/outputs符合查询条件的设备关系类型总数。表5 RelationType 参数名称类型必选(M)/可选(O)参数位置参数含义idStringMrelationType设备关系ID。codeStringOrelationType设备关系类型编码。relationNameStringOrelationType设备关系类型名称。relationModeStringOrelationType设备关系类型模式。descriptionStringOrelationType设备关系类型描述。响应样例{ "resCode": "0", "resMsg": "成功", "result": [ { "count": 11, "relationType": [ { "code": "testRelation", "description": "", "id": "0F24000000oVdyA3bNDs", "relationMode": "ADJACENT", "relationName": "testRelation" }, { "code": "pytest", "description": "", "id": "0F24000000oVdyCZ9XyC", "relationMode": "ADJACENT", "relationName": "pytest" }, { "code": "pytest_devRelatioTypeUpdate", "description": "", "id": "0F24000000lcRXRtBf3g", "relationMode": "ADJACENT", "relationName": "pytest" }, { "code": "PowerSupplyRelationship", "description": "", "id": "0F24000000kkLgFTHlei", "relationMode": "ADJACENT", "relationName": "供电关系" }, { "code": "yewuTest", "description": "设备故障联动关联", "id": "0F24000000jXNLkgNZ2G", "relationMode": "ADJACENT", "relationName": "设备关联关系" } ] } ] }
  • [问题求助] sysLog能接子系统的日志嘛
    sysLog能接子系统的日志嘛
  • [技术干货] 登录沃土数字平台网页报403或418解决办法
    登录沃土数字平台网页报403报错现象:报错原因:您的运营商网络已提供IPv6的访问方式,但是运营商网络未配置IPv6地址转换IPv4地址,并且沃土数字平台不支持IPv6的访问方式,导致网页显示“403 Forbidden”,关于IPv6地址和IPv4地址的区别,您可以参考:https://zhuanlan.zhihu.com/p/271708071解决办法(任选一种方法即可):方法一:等待运营商运维人员割接,支持将IPv6转换为IPv4地址方法二:更换您当地接入网络的运营商,例如您使用联通换成移动,移动换成电信等方法三:将您电脑接入网络的网卡属性里“Internet协议版本6(TCP/IPv6)”前面的勾去掉,然后在“命令提示符”里使用命令:“ipconfig/release”释放地址,再使用命令:“ipconfig/renew”重新获得地址,确保您访问沃土数字平台的电脑未再获得运营商给您提供的IPv6地址即可。问题解决验证:红框处访问沃土数字平台的IP地址已经由IPv6地址恢复为IPv4地址登录沃土数字平台网页报418报错现象:报错原因和解决办法:由于国家护网等原因,沃土数字平台使用了WAF防护功能,您的网页上出现了“418”说明您的访问请求被WAF拦截了,您可以提供一下:您的事件ID(请注意,为加快问题处理速度,请您不要粘贴图片,粘贴文字即可)您的公网IP地址(如下图所示,百度“IP”即可,为加快问题处理速度,请您不要粘贴图片,粘贴文字即可):​​​​​​最后请您耐心等待沃土数字平台安全运维人员对您的公网IP地址放通
总条数:643 到第
上滑加载中